GameStop will carry new Nexus 7 tablet

Retailer to offer latest tablet from Google in stores and online; $230 and $270 models available ahead of schedule through website.

Retailer GameStop will carry the new Google Nexus 7 tablet, the company has announced.

Beginning July 30, consumers can buy the $230 16GB model and $270 32GB version at all United States stores.

Consumers looking to buy online won't have to wait, as the tablet is available today ahead of schedule through the retailer's website.

“We are happy to partner with Google to carry the next installment of their Nexus 7 tablet,” GameStop mobile vice president Joe Gorman said in a statement.

The new Google Nexus 7 features Android Jelly Bean 4.3, a front- and rear-facing camera, and a 7" screen. GameStop also announced that, for a limited time, customers can receive 30 percent extra in-store credit on any items traded towards the purchase of the new Nexus 7.
